Transaction e61eeae316dcf358feccc4dd7970c6092a0bc760e770c34d43a0d44ce3be38f3

1 Input
2 Outputs
  • e61eeae316dcf358feccc4dd7970c6092a0bc760e770c34d43a0d44ce3be38f3:0
  • value  6711800
    address  1D8NpMgkakD9jsBUq2uhtzgEpvEsgLdxdw
  • e61eeae316dcf358feccc4dd7970c6092a0bc760e770c34d43a0d44ce3be38f3:1
  • value  97636248
    address  15kVahqHYWz7jFzRDwD5UtQ4NhA2MviFGA